Electronica label founded by Martin Haidinger and Tony Douglas. A lot of changes happened around Toy 5: Chris Cunningham joined the label with Toy 5, and Tony left the label after Toy 5. Distribution also changed with Toy 5 to Southern Record Distribution (SRD); the first four releases were distributed by Metropolis Record Distribution. All graphics for every release except Toy 17 done by Martin Haidinger (the credit does not appear on most of the actual releases).
